Scissor Lift Weight: 9+ Types & Specs

The mass of a specific scissor lift is not a fixed value but depends significantly on its design and intended use. Factors influencing a unit’s weight include its platform size, lifting height, load capacity, and the materials used in its construction. Smaller, electric scissor lifts designed for indoor use might weigh a few hundred kilograms, while larger, diesel-powered models capable of lifting heavy loads to significant heights can weigh several tons. Understanding this range is essential for safe operation and transport.

Knowing the weight is crucial for several reasons. Transporting a scissor lift requires selecting an appropriate trailer and towing vehicle with sufficient capacity. Proper weight distribution is essential for stability during transport and operation. Furthermore, weight is a factor in determining ground-bearing pressure, a critical consideration when working on sensitive surfaces or near underground utilities. 7+ Chin Lift Costs: 2023 Price Guide

The price of mentoplasty, a surgical procedure designed to reshape the chin, varies considerably based on several factors. These include the surgical technique employed (implant, sliding genioplasty, or reduction), the surgeon’s experience and fees, the location of the practice, anesthesia costs, and any necessary pre- or post-operative care. For example, a simple chin implant procedure might have a different price point than a more complex jaw restructuring.

Bench Warrant Costs: Fees & Lifting Process

Recalling an outstanding warrant typically involves several expenses. These can include a bond to ensure future court appearances, administrative fees assessed by the court, and potentially legal representation costs if an attorney is retained. The specific amounts vary significantly based on jurisdiction, the nature of the underlying offense, and individual circumstances. For example, a minor traffic violation may have lower associated costs than a more serious charge. Failing to address an outstanding warrant can lead to further legal complications, including arrest and additional penalties.

7+ Home Lift Costs & Prices (2024)

Determining the expense associated with acquiring and installing a vertical transportation system involves numerous factors. These include the type of conveyance (e.g., hydraulic, traction, pneumatic), its capacity, the number of floors it serves, the building’s structural requirements, and additional features such as custom finishes or accessibility options. A simple residential installation in a two-story home will have significantly different pricing than a complex, high-speed system in a multi-story commercial building. Truck Lift Kits: Cost & Pricing Guide (2024)

The expense associated with raising a truck’s suspension or body varies significantly depending on several factors. A simple leveling kit might cost a few hundred dollars, while a complete suspension overhaul with high-end components and professional installation could reach several thousand dollars. Examples of factors influencing price include the type of lift (suspension, body, leveling), the specific components used (shocks, springs, control arms), the vehicle’s make and model, and labor costs.

Modifying a truck’s ride height offers numerous advantages, from enhanced off-road capability and ground clearance to improved aesthetics and tire clearance for larger wheels. 2023 Arm Lift Cost: 6+ Price Factors

The cost of brachioplasty, a surgical procedure to reshape the upper arms, varies significantly. Factors influencing the final price include surgeon’s fees, anesthesia costs, operating room expenses, pre-operative and post-operative care, and geographical location. Potential patients should also consider the extent of correction required, as more extensive procedures may incur higher costs.

Reshaping the upper arms can address concerns about excess skin and fat, often resulting in improved body contour and increased self-confidence. This procedure can be particularly beneficial for individuals who have experienced significant weight loss, resulting in loose or sagging skin.
